The Farmers' Daughter is based on the knowledge that people love to eat the freshest fruit and vegetables. Owners Amy Icenhour Douglas and Jason Douglas have a family history and hard work ethic required to grow the highest quality vegetables around. Amy is the daughter of Vinson and Mary Ann Icenhour, vegetable farmers from Taylorsville, NC. Her family has farmed the same land for at least 7 generations. "It's what we know how to do," Amy said. "You can't get it any fresher than right out of our garden or fresh off the trees or plants of our local growers!" After pursuing her Master's Degree in Civil/Environmental Engineering and the birth of their daughter, Lily, Amy went back to her roots. She wanted to raise her daughter the way that she was raised; right beside her mom and dad. She is now 2 years old and has been joined by baby brother, Max. Jason brings a hard work ethic and ingenuity to the operation that the green thumb (Amy) does not have. He is the son Steve and Cecilia Douglas. Steve is a lifetime mason and Jason works with his father in the family business (Douglas Masonry).
